Explaining why the universe can be transparent

Monday, September 12, 2016 - 17:51 in Astronomy & Space

Two papers published by an assistant professor at the University of California, Riverside and several collaborators explain why the universe has enough energy to become transparent. The study led by Naveen Reddy, an assistant professor in the Department of Physics and Astronomy at UC Riverside, marks the first quantitative study of how the gas content […]
